Output 8a755fa32983b8a7fcd566cfb2e9c2dfacc4ddf3a01c0818c9e75aafc916567a:0

value
341139840
script pubkey
OP_0 OP_PUSHBYTES_20 cdc79ad89f7f1025e059464b7940f0e93d5ea5fb
address
bc1qehre4kyl0ugztczege9hjs8say74af0mkkwv3d
transaction
8a755fa32983b8a7fcd566cfb2e9c2dfacc4ddf3a01c0818c9e75aafc916567a
confirmations
137503
spent
true